Prestonfield House: Baroque Elegance with a Touch of Magic

Prestonfield House: Built in 1687 by Sir William Bruce, architect of Holyroodhouse, Prestonfield House became James Thomson’s own residence in 2003. After a multimillion-pound restoration, the house gleams anew, its white walls and square-paned windows hiding a world of classical Baroque splendor.

Eighteen rooms and five suites are named after distinguished guests—Sir Winston Churchill, Benjamin Franklin, Allan Ramsay—each adorned with luxurious wallpapers and warm tones, immersing visitors in a romantic, storybook atmosphere.

The Witchery by the Castle: Legendary Charm

Just steps from Edinburgh Castle, The Witchery by the Castle occupies a cluster of 16th-century buildings, restored by James Thomson in 1979. Its name nods to the city’s legends, evoking mystery and historical intrigue without touching on the supernatural.

Inside, nine suites feature Baroque-inspired décor, gilded mirrors, roll-top baths, and sumptuous velvet fabrics. Every room feels like stepping into a wizarding tale, where history and luxury entwine, creating an atmosphere of romance and adventure.

Nightly rates: £350–£800
